Jhpiego, an affiliate of Johns Hopkins University, is an international NGO supporting health programs to improve the health of women and their families. Jhpiego – Kenya works in close collaboration with both the Ministry of Medical Services and the Ministry of Public Health and Sanitation in the areas of HIV, Malaria, TB, Maternal, Newborn and Child Health, Reproductive Health and Family Planning. STORES MANAGER

Reporting to the Senior Administration Manager, the Stores Manager will be responsible for Jhpiego stores which contain reference manuals, books, journals, training materials, humanistic models and office supplies. S/he will establish the optimal stock levels and initiate replenishment for the stores items. S/he will ensure proper functioning and utilization of stores manual and electronic systems and roll out the systems to other Jhpiego field offices.

Responsibilities
  • Provide management of the Stores function for the organization
  • Identify gaps in current system; suggest and implemented improvement to the system
  • Oversees the maintenance of the Jhpiego Inventory Management System and ensures that all materials are properly stored and accurately accounted for
  • Generating purchase requests, verify and receive all items ordered as per the LPO specifications
  • Ensure that the store is orderly arranged, items well labeled and kept clean and safe
  • Ensure stores security and proper usage of loaner materials and ensure materials loaned out are returned in good condition
  • Coordinate the physical inventory of all Nairobi & field offices assets on a semi-annual basis and update the asset register regularly
